Transaction dec6bc89ea0931f9e34f3fffb7e424238ffca37c19c851a0174f5f68f8280f2d

2 Input
2 Outputs
  • dec6bc89ea0931f9e34f3fffb7e424238ffca37c19c851a0174f5f68f8280f2d:0
  • value  65680820
    address  34W1R9rm6CHJVPUKaPCUxioo3wfsYFEiKZ
  • dec6bc89ea0931f9e34f3fffb7e424238ffca37c19c851a0174f5f68f8280f2d:1
  • value  284000000
    address  3QKD7zPTVJ8hJncqB2yRGAqoa5syaZKTQ6